Summary of reviewsHotel Sakura, located at the gateway to Chefchaouen's enchanting old town, offers its guests an exceptional stay with its unbeatable location and welcoming atmosphere. The hotel is ideally positioned just steps away from the famous Medina, surrounded by stunning mountain views and captivating architecture. This makes it a prime spot for exploring the vibrant culture and iconic blue hues of Chefchaouen, while still ensuring tranquility and easy access to local amenities and attractions.

The breakfast experience at Hotel Sakura is highly praised for its quality and abundance. Guests enjoy a wide variety of fresh, home-style options, often enhanced by the breathtaking views from the rooftop terrace. The breakfast, described as both a visual and culinary delight, is considered one of the best in Morocco, providing a great start to the day.

The rooms at Hotel Sakura are noted for their coziness, cleanliness, and tasteful decor. Guests appreciate the comfortable beds and peaceful environments, with charming details and decor enhancing their stay. Although some guests note that room renovations, particularly in the bathrooms, could be beneficial, the overall room experience remains positive and pleasant.

Cleanliness is a standout feature, with meticulous attention ensuring spotless guest rooms and welcoming common spaces. The hotel's serene and hygienic environment provides a comfortable retreat for travelers.

Staff hospitality is another highlight, with guests frequently commending the friendly and attentive nature of the staff. The owner, along with team members like Abdul and Zacarías, is recognized for their dedication to guest satisfaction. The cultural insights provided by the owner, who has lived extensively in Japan, add a unique touch to the guest experience.

While Wi-Fi performance can be mixed, some guests laud the reliable connection suitable for business purposes, though others note intermittent issues. Finally, the beds are a significant comfort factor, offering plush quality that fosters a restful sleep, with any firmness concerns swiftly addressed by the attentive staff.

In summary, Hotel Sakura combines an ideal location, excellent service, delectable meals, and comfortable accommodations to create an inviting and memorable experience for travelers seeking to explore Chefchaouen's cultural heart.
